How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cortland?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Cortland Studio Apartments | $870 | $575 | $1,705 |
Cortland 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,183 | $635 | $2,120 |
Cortland 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,410 | $450 | $2,825 |
Cortland 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,294 | $789 | $2,750 |
Cortland 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,203 | $1,040 | $2,950 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
